Carbon nanomaterials in oncology: an expanding horizon
Drug Discovery Today ( IF 6.5 ) Pub Date : 2017-09-28 , DOI: 10.1016/j.drudis.2017.09.013
Neelesh K. Mehra , Amit K. Jain , Manoj Nahar

Carbon nanomaterials have been attracting attention in oncology for the development of safe and effective cancer nanomedicines in increasing improved patient compliance for generally recognized as safe (GRAS) prominence. Toxicity, safety and efficacy of carbon nanomaterials are the major concerns in cancer theranostics. Various parameters such as particle size and shape or surface morphology, surface charge, composition, oxidation and nonoxidative-stress-related mechanisms are prone to toxicity of the carbon nanomaterials. Currently, few cancer-related products have been available on the market, although some are underway in preclinical and clinical phases. Thus, our main aim is to provide comprehensive details on the carbon nanomaterials in oncology from the past two decades for patient compliance and safety.
